💡Why upgrade to Oppo Reno

The Oppo Reno 15 series delivers a significant upgrade in 2026, with the Pro model packing a 200MP main camera, 50MP periscope telephoto with 3.5x zoom, Dimensity 8450 chip, and an IP68/IP69 dual rating. The lineup spans from the compact Reno 15 Pro to the larger Pro Max with 6,200mAh+ batteries — all running Android 16 with ColorOS 16.

FAQs

What is the latest Oppo Reno model?

The latest models are the Oppo Reno 15 and Reno 15 Pro, launched globally in January 2026. The Pro model features a 200MP main camera, a 50MP periscope telephoto lens with 3.5x optical zoom, and IP68/IP69 water resistance.

How good is Oppo's portrait mode?

Oppo is known for excellent portrait photography with natural-looking background blur and accurate skin tones. The Reno series inherits this expertise.

How fast does the Reno 14 charge?

The Reno 14 series features 80W SuperVOOC fast charging, capable of fully charging in approximately 30-35 minutes.

Does Oppo Reno get regular updates?

Oppo provides 3 years of major Android updates and 4 years of security patches for the Reno series.

Should I buy Oppo Reno or Samsung Galaxy A?

Choose Reno if you prioritize design, faster charging, and portrait photography. Choose Galaxy A if you want longer software support and Samsung's ecosystem integration.

Is the Reno 14 Pro worth the extra cost over the standard Reno 14?

The Pro adds a telephoto camera, larger display, and slightly better build quality. If you value zoom photography and a bigger screen, it's worth it. Otherwise, the standard Reno 14 offers excellent value.

Is the Oppo Reno 15 series worth buying in 2026?

Yes, it's one of the most compelling mid-range launches of early 2026. The Reno 15 Pro's 200MP main camera, 50MP periscope zoom, and IP68/IP69 rating deliver near-flagship camera hardware at a mid-range price. The massive 6,200mAh+ battery and 80W fast charging add excellent daily usability.

How does the Oppo Reno 15 Pro compare to the Samsung Galaxy A56?

The Reno 15 Pro leads on camera hardware — its 200MP main sensor and periscope telephoto far exceed the Galaxy A56's setup. The Galaxy A56 counters with Samsung's longer software support (4 years of OS updates) and deeper ecosystem integration. If camera quality is your top priority, the Reno 15 Pro wins clearly; if you want long-term update certainty, go Samsung.
